Join Optum as an Associate Patient Care Coordinator, where you'll play a vital role in supporting patients and clinical staff in a mental health setting. In this full-time position, you will be responsible for patient check-in/check-out, ensuring paperwork accuracy, and assisting with various patient care duties while contributing to a compassionate and efficient healthcare environment.
Key Responsibilities
Review each patient’s chart prior to appointment and ensure consents and insurance verification is complete
Complete patients check in and check out; obtain registration forms, collect and upload insurance cards and identification, verify completion of consents and confirm insurance eligibility
Assist with onboarding new patients, help patients access patient portal, prepare and confirm completion of paperwork
Process payments or co-pays, deductibles, co-insurance, self-pay, and missed appointment fees
Assist in update and/or scheduling of existing patients, including assisting with internal referrals initiated by the provider
Answer phone calls and return voicemails; record all requests in the EHR system for Physician follow-up
Support prescribers in filing prior authorizations for insurance and submitting and monitoring lab tests and results
Order and restock supplies
Monitor clinician/admin/OBC inbox and respond accordingly
Ensure all locations are welcoming and adhere to brand guidelines
Secure patient information and maintain patient confidentiality
Obtain and record vital signs, weight, medication profile, allergies, chief complaint, signature/initials where appropriate before appointment with Psychiatrist
Gather patient history, collateral documentation and updates for patient chart
Administer screening tools
